Heartwarming donation to ambos

Students raise money to help our hardworking paramedics.

Ross Park Primary School students Roy Sweeney, 9, and Jemima Hemmes, 11, with St John Ambulance Australia NT paramedic Amy McCaffrey. Picture: EMMA MURRAY
Ross Park Primary School students Roy Sweeney, 9, and Jemima Hemmes, 11, with St John Ambulance Australia NT paramedic Amy McCaffrey. Picture: EMMA MURRAY

Students at Ross Park Primary School donated almost $300 to St John Ambulance Australia Northern Territory on Friday following a successful fundraiser on Harmony Day.

Grade four student Roy Sweeney, 9, said the school thought St John Ambulance was an appropriate recipient of the $287 donation “because the whole coronavirus thing has probably been pretty hard for the paramedics”.

St John NT CEO Judith Barker said it was great to see our younger community members working together to make a positive impact.

“These funds will support our free First Aid in Schools program, allowing us to continue in our mission to make first aid a part of every Territorian’s life,” she said.
